Kraftwerk's Karl Bartos New Album To Be Released Worldwide In March 2013

The album is called 'Off The Record', and according to the press release, that title comes from the record drawing on off the record ideas Bartos had while he was still a member of Kraftwerk.

The explanation continues to reveal that the album will offer up "iron crystal music, vocoder newspeak, robot sounds, digital glitch, Techno, catchy melodies, electronic avant-garde, roaring silence, futurism, and, of course, those rhythms!"

'Off the Record' will arrive on March 18, 2013.

Klaxons Working With The Chemical Brothers On New Album

Klaxons have revealed they are enlisting the help of a number of different producers as they continue work on a new album, one of which is The Chemical Brothers‘ Ed Simons. In telling BBC Radio 1 DJ Zane Lowe that the recording process for their third studio album has proved to be a ‘learning curve’ for the band.
 
Klaxons' bassist Jamie Reynolds
“We’ve worked with loads of different people, but it’s been a learning process I think. We have learned to make electronic music with computers, that’s been our mission over the last however long.” “It’s been about a year’s worth of learning electronics and computers, which is something that we didn’t know anything about. I wouldn’t know how to have made an electronic drumbeat until this time last year.”

Top 5 Books For DJs

DJ books
DJs are everywhere bands used to be: school dances, wedding receptions, birthday parties, bars, clubs, and lately in championships where turntablists battle each other with their beat-juggling and mixing skills which often encompass acrobatics, lol. In 2004, for the first time, a DJ even played the opening ceremony of the Olympics held in Athens. As sales of DJ equipment (turntables, CDJs, mixers, midi controllers) have grown to rival those of guitars and drum sets, books now talk about the emergence of the DJ as full-fledged musicians have emerged, too.
 
Here are the Top 5 Books For DJs
 
1 - Last Night A DJ Saved My Life
Author: Bill Brewster and Frank Broughton
The title says it all; inspired by the name of a 1982 r&b song by Indeep, no doubt millions of dance floor habitues have woken up after a magical night of dancing and thought just that thought. "A truly great DJ, just for a moment, can make a whole room fall in love," say the authors in this entertaining biography of the DJ, with club charts from the mid-50s through the end of the '90s. Their How to DJ Right: The Art and Science of Playing Records, is even more fun.
 
 
2 - DJ Skills: The Essential Guide to Mixing & Scratching
Author: Stephen Webber
DJ Skills: The Essential Guide to Mixing & Scratching is the most comprehensive, up to date approach to DJing ever produced. With insights from top club, mobile, and scratch DJs, the book includes many teaching strategies developed in the Berklee College of Music prototype DJ lab. This book is perfect for intermediate and advanced DJs looking to improve their skills in both the analogue and digital domain.

The 10 Best Acid House Tracks According To DJ Pierre

Best Acid House Tracks
Chicago producer DJ Pierre is credited as one of the founders of Acid House. He was one third of production trio Phuture, whose seminal 1987 EP ‘Acid Tracks’ inspired a generation. With Acid currently riding high in the charts as DJ Pierre sagely points out below, here’s a timely look back at its roots with his ten favourites Acid moments!

Modeselektor 80 Min. Boiler Room Berlin DJ Set

Modeselektor are an electronic band from Berlin. The duo originally met in 1992, but it wasn't until 1996 that they began performing under the guise of 'Modeselektor'. They signed to BPitch Control in 2000, having met and befriended Ellen Allien.
 
A series of singles, EPs and remixes ensued, along with exciting collaboration with Parisian rap group TTC as well as Berlin wunderkind Apparat under the name Moderat. Modeselektor began to draw international attention and soon snagged the ears of one Thom Yorke, who declared his love for their music on television. Now immersed in the European artistic community, the producers did an exclusive performance at the Boiler Room Berlin.

Kraftwerk Doing Eight New Concerts In Germany

Kraftwerk, the fathers of electronic music have booked up for eight concerts at Düsseldorf in January (2013). The idea is to play every one of their albums entirely! Kraftwerk will now repeat the performance from last spring when they played eight concerts at the Museum of Modern Art in New York. This time, however, will take place at their homeland, Germany.
 
Kraftwerk will play at the Kunstsammlung Nordrhein-Westfalen museum in Düsseldorf. The concert goers will enjoy the performance of all their albums, from 1974 'Autobahn' to the 2003 'Tour de France'.  The dates of the concert has been confirmed as January 11 to 13 and 16 to 20 next year.

35,000 Ravers Attended The Electronic Music Festival ⇒ I Love Techno 2012

The electronic music festival I Love Techno was held Saturday night in Ghent, Belgium. The last edition of I Love Techno proceeded smoothly and without problems. Despite the presence of 350 police officers and 300 security guards, nobody was arrested, that concludes the spokesman of the Ghent police, Manuel Mugica Gonzalez.
 
35,000 lovers of Techno music were reunited for the first time at the largest hall in Flanders Expo for approximately 6 long hours. On the 17th edition of the festival,  people enjoyed the live sets from the likes of Netsky, Boys Noize, Nero, Dave Clarke, Major Lazer, Vitalic, Jamie XX, A-Trak, Chris Liebing and DJ Fresh. Daft Punk Member Thomas Bangalter's 1995 EP Gets A Reissue

Trax On Da Rocks is a classic EP and the first first ever release from Daft Punk member Thomas Bangalter. This material has been re-pressed, it includes five tracks of sublime dance floor concoctions from the Daft Punk auteur. From the syrupy electro-disco of the title track, to the jump-up Techno of "Roulé Boulé" to the filter fest that is "Ventura".

Stream the uplifting Techno track of "Roulé Boulé" below, check out the tracklist, and cop this essential re-release at fine retailers like our friends at Phonica.

On the other hand, Bangalter recently composed an ominous score for Lindsay Lohan’s short film called First Point, which is a bit less notable than his score for Irreversible or Daft Punk’s effort for Tron: Legacy.

'Trax On Da Rocks' tracklist:  On Da Rocks - Roulé Boulé - What To Do - Outrun - Ventura

Dr Lektroluv Full Unmasked Photo + Real Identity Revealed

Dr Lektroluv real name is Stefaan Vandenberghe, he is a Belgian DJ known in Europe as The Man With The Green Mask. During his live sets he wears an elegant tuxedo jacket.  He also runs the Lektroluv label, with releases from Mumbai Science, Modek, Sound Of Stereo, etc. Initially, when he started as a DJ he wore a white doctor's uniform, and used to be known under the alias of T-Quest.

In the late 80s and early 90s Dr Lektroluv used to have a great radio show named 'Behind The Beat' on Radio S.I.S in Ghent, Belgium.  During those times he was simply known as Stefaan Vandenberghe, his radio show focused on underground electronic music and Acid House. He also used to be a resident DJ at the 'Kaos' parties held at Cherrymoon during  the '90s, and today he is one of the most popular Techno DJs of Europe, that has never shown his face in public. This case is similar to other masked DJs who dominate the electronic music scene, such as Daft Punk and The Bloody Beetroots.
